Device Fractures Could Lead to Revision Surgery and Other Health Consequences

Due to a higher fracture rate than stated on the device’s label, Zimmer Biomet is recalling certain model numbers of their Comprehensive Reverse Shoulder System. According to a recall notice issued by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), fractures may cause patients to have revision surgeries which may lead to other health consequences, including permanent loss of shoulder function, infection, or in rare cases, death. Over 3,000 devices manufactured from August 25, 2008 to September 27, 2011, are included in the recall. The FDA’s recall notice contains a full list of lot numbers.

The Comprehensive Reverse Shoulder system is a shoulder replacement device designed to help restore movement and is reportedly beneficial for patients with rotator cuff tears who have developed arthropathy, a severe type of shoulder arthritis. Initially recalled on December 15, 2016, Zimmer Biomet has asked customers to review the safety notice sent to customers in December 2016, and to identify and quarantine any affected devices in stock. The FDA reports that there are no additional specific patient monitoring instructions related to the recall in addition to existing surgical follow up protocols.

Medical device makers have a duty to provide safe products. If there are risks of harm associated with their devices, they also must provide adequate warnings. If a device maker fails to fulfill this duty, it could be held liable in lawsuits for injuries that may result.

People injured by a defective shoulder replacement may be eligible to recover money for:

  • Medical Expenses
  • Lost Wages
  • Pain and Suffering

The families of those killed may be eligible to recover money for funeral expenses and the pain that comes with losing a loved one.
